<h1>Calculate a time course of relative concentrations based on an mkinmod model</h1>
<small class="dont-index">Source: <a href="https://github.com/jranke/pfm/blob/HEAD/R/pfm_degradation.R" class="external-link"><code>R/pfm_degradation.R</code></a></small>
<div class="d-none name"><code>pfm_degradation.Rd</code></div>
</div>
<div class="ref-description section level2">
<p>Calculate a time course of relative concentrations based on an mkinmod model</p>
</div>
<div class="section level2">
<h2 id="ref-usage">Usage<a class="anchor" aria-label="anchor" href="#ref-usage"></a></h2>
<div class="sourceCode"><pre class="sourceCode r"><code><span><span class="fu">pfm_degradation</span><span class="op">(</span></span>
<span> model <span class="op">=</span> <span class="st">"SFO"</span>,</span>
<span> DT50 <span class="op">=</span> <span class="fl">1000</span>,</span>
<span> parms <span class="op">=</span> <span class="fu"><a href="https://rdrr.io/r/base/c.html" class="external-link">c</a></span><span class="op">(</span>k_parent <span class="op">=</span> <span class="fu"><a href="https://rdrr.io/r/base/Log.html" class="external-link">log</a></span><span class="op">(</span><span class="fl">2</span><span class="op">)</span><span class="op">/</span><span class="va">DT50</span><span class="op">)</span>,</span>
<span> years <span class="op">=</span> <span class="fl">1</span>,</span>
<span> step_days <span class="op">=</span> <span class="fl">1</span>,</span>
<span> times <span class="op">=</span> <span class="fu"><a href="https://rdrr.io/r/base/seq.html" class="external-link">seq</a></span><span class="op">(</span><span class="fl">0</span>, <span class="va">years</span> <span class="op">*</span> <span class="fl">365</span>, by <span class="op">=</span> <span class="va">step_days</span><span class="op">)</span></span>
<span><span class="op">)</span></span></code></pre></div>
</div>
<div class="section level2">
<h2 id="arguments">Arguments<a class="anchor" aria-label="anchor" href="#arguments"></a></h2>
<dl><dt id="arg-model">model<a class="anchor" aria-label="anchor" href="#arg-model"></a></dt>
<dd><p>The degradation model to be used. Either a parent only model like
'SFO' or 'FOMC', or an mkinmod object</p></dd>
<dt id="arg-dt-">DT50<a class="anchor" aria-label="anchor" href="#arg-dt-"></a></dt>
<dd><p>The half-life. This is only used when simple exponential decline
is calculated (SFO model).</p></dd>
<dt id="arg-parms">parms<a class="anchor" aria-label="anchor" href="#arg-parms"></a></dt>
<dd><p>The parameters used for the degradation model</p></dd>
<dt id="arg-years">years<a class="anchor" aria-label="anchor" href="#arg-years"></a></dt>
<dd><p>For how many years should the degradation be predicted?</p></dd>
<dt id="arg-step-days">step_days<a class="anchor" aria-label="anchor" href="#arg-step-days"></a></dt>
<dd><p>What step size in days should the output have?</p></dd>
<dt id="arg-times">times<a class="anchor" aria-label="anchor" href="#arg-times"></a></dt>
<dd><p>The output times</p></dd>
</dl></div>
<div class="section level2">
<h2 id="value">Value<a class="anchor" aria-label="anchor" href="#value"></a></h2>
<p>A data frame containing the output times and the concentrations
assuming initial concentrations of 1 for the parent and zero for
metabolites, if any.</p>
